Playa de las Teresitas is a stunning, man-made beach located in the northeastern part of Tenerife, one of Spain’s Canary Islands. This picturesque beach is renowned for its golden sands, which were imported from the Sahara Desert to create an idyllic setting unlike the natural black volcanic sands typical of Tenerife. Extending for about 1.5 kilometers, Playa de las Teresitas offers calm, turquoise waters thanks to an artificial breakwater that shields it from strong currents, making it a perfect spot for families and those looking to relax. The beach is flanked by the lush, green backdrop of the Anaga Mountains, adding to its scenic beauty. Facilities include sunbeds, umbrellas, showers, and several beach bars, known locally as "chiringuitos," where you can enjoy a refreshing drink or a light meal. Its proximity to the capital city, Santa Cruz de Tenerife, makes it a convenient escape for both locals and tourists.
